Abstract

The invention relates to a treatment system for a motorcycle manufacturing material. The treatment system for the motorcycle manufacturing material comprises a feeding system. A left lifting system is arranged on the right side of the feeding system. A feeding pipe mechanism is arranged at the upper portion of the right side of the left lifting system. A smashing system is arranged at the lower portion of the feeding pipe mechanism. A material return pipe mechanism is arranged at the lower portion of the left side of the smashing system. A discharging pipe mechanism is arranged on the left side of the material return pipe mechanism. A material return system is arranged at the lower portion of the discharging pipe mechanism. The left side of the material return system is connected with the lower portion of the right side of the left lifting system. A separation treatment plate is installed at the lower portion of the smashing system, and a discharging system is installed at the lower portion of the separation treatment plate. A discharging oblique table is installed at the lower portion of the discharging system, and a feeding system is arranged on the right side of the discharging system. The treatment system can be used for lifting the motorcycle manufacturing material efficiently and then conducing smashing treatment, and use is convenient.

A kind of motorcycle manufactures material handling system, including feed system, left lift system is provided with the right side of feed system, left lift system right upper portion is provided with feeder sleeve mechanism, feeder sleeve mechanism bottom is provided with crushing system, crushing system left lower is provided with feed back pipe mechanism, tremie pipe mechanism is provided with the left of feed back pipe mechanism, tremie pipe mechanism bottom is provided with material return system, it is connected with left lift system lower right side on the left of material return system, crushing system bottom is provided with separating treatment plate, separating treatment plate bottom is provided with blanking system, blanking system bottom is provided with blanking sloping platform, feeding system is provided with the right side of blanking system, right lift system is provided with the right side of feeding system, right lift system right upper portion is provided with discharge nozzle mechanism, discharge nozzle mechanism bottom is provided with discharge system, discharge system bottom is provided with multiple discharge openings;Left lift system and right lift system top are separately installed with the first dynamical system and the second dynamical system, first dynamical system and the second dynamical system bottom are respectively equipped with left dynamical system axle and right dynamical system axle, and left dynamical system axle and right dynamical system axle side are separately installed with left hoisting mechanism and right hoisting mechanism;The crushing system left and right sides is separately installed with the 3rd dynamical system and the 4th dynamical system, inside crushing system, the left and right sides is separately installed with left extruding rotating mechanism and right extruding rotating mechanism, left power transmission mechanism is provided between 3rd dynamical system and left extruding rotating mechanism, between the 4th dynamical system and right extruding rotating mechanism, right power transmission mechanism is provided with.
Further, the blanking sloping platform left and right sides is separately installed with the 5th dynamical system and eccentric, is provided with lower power transmission mechanism between the 5th dynamical system and eccentric.
Further, telecontrol equipment is mounted on the right side of material return system bottom and blanking sloping platform bottom.
In the system, motorcycle manufacturing material is poured into left lift system bottom from feed system, in the presence of the first dynamical system, left dynamical system axle drives left hoisting mechanism to rotate, using left hoisting mechanism by motorcycle manufacture material from lower lift to top, when motorcycle manufactures material reaches feeder sleeve mechanism position, motorcycle is manufactured material and enters crushing system from feeder sleeve mechanism.In the presence of the 3rd dynamical system and the 4th dynamical system, left power transmission mechanism and right power transmission mechanism drive left extruding rotating mechanism and right extruding rotating mechanism to rotate respectively, material is manufactured to motorcycle to extrude, makes motorcycle manufacture material disintegrating.Material is manufactured through the motorcycle of pulverization process to drop on separating treatment plate, motorcycle is manufactured separating treatment hole of the material powder from separating treatment plate and enters blanking system, and the motorcycle do not crushed is manufactured material and kept off in crushing system by separating treatment plate.The valve switch in feed back pipe mechanism is opened, and motorcycle is manufactured material and feed back pipe mechanism slipped into along separating treatment plate, then enters material return system from tremie pipe mechanism, and motorcycle manufacturing material returns to left lift system bottom and proceeds to lift crushing.Motorcycle is manufactured material powder and is dropped on blanking sloping platform, in the presence of the 5th dynamical system, lower power transmission mechanism band movable eccentric wheel is rotated, blanking sloping platform top is beaten using eccentric, enable motorcycle to manufacture material powder and preferably slip into right lift system bottom, it is to avoid powder is remained on blanking sloping platform.In the presence of the second dynamical system, right dynamical system axle drives right hoisting mechanism to rotate, by motorcycle manufacturing material powder from lower lift to top, motorcycle to be manufactured and enter discharge system from discharge nozzle mechanism when material powder reaches discharge nozzle mechanism position, and motorcycle is manufactured material powder and used from discharge opening discharge again.
